About this horse

$6,500 USD NEGOTIABLE Big (15.2), beautiful, double registered 20-year-old palomino gelding. Has been trail ridden, has ran barrels (youth 3D & open 4D/5D depending on show) & poles (23/24s) , and been in a few parades. Hasn’t been ridden consistently the past 5 years due to my personal health. He’s sitting in the pasture and needs to go to someone that will utilize him. Not a beginner horse. Would be good for an experienced kid for 4-H or 4D jackpots. He trims, clips, loads, easy to catch. No maintenance, but is currently fat and out of shape. Might buck in place when left tied at the trailer. The more you haul him, he will quit. We hauled him just fine. Has never been stalled inside due to room, but does fine in an outdoor stall. Barefoot and on pasture. Negotiable to the right person.
